Data Engineer - Databricks (No Sponsorship Available)

Essential Functions

  • Design, implement, and maintain scalable data pipelines within a cloud data platform (Azure preferred)
  • Build, optimize, and manage Databricks clusters, ensuring performance, cost efficiency, and reliable job execution
  • Develop and maintain Delta Lake tables, pipelines, and storage patterns to ensure data quality, versioning, and performance
  • Integrate Databricks with Azure services such as Azure Data Factory, ADLS, and Azure DevOps
  • Support the implementation of a new cloud-based data warehouse, defining architecture, governance, and standards
  • Build and automate CI/CD pipelines for data workflows using Azure DevOps
  • Design and implement monitoring solutions using Databricks monitoring tools, Azure Log Analytics, or custom dashboards
  • Collaborate with business and technical stakeholders to identify high-value data engineering and analytics opportunities and contribute to data governance initiatives

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Data Science, or a related field required
  • 3+ years of experience in data engineering or cloud data architecture
  • Expertise in Databricks or Snowflake Cloud Data Platforms
  • Expertise with programming languages such as Python and/or SQL
  • Experience with Python Data Science Libraries (PySpark, Pandas, etc.)
  • Experience with Test Drive Development (TDD)
  • Automated CI/CD Pipelines
  • Linux / Bash / Docker
  • Database Schema Design and Optimization
  • Experience working in a cloud environment (Azure preferred) with strong understanding of cloud data architecture
  • Experience with workflow orchestration (e.g., Databricks Jobs, or Azure Data Factory pipelines)

Skills And Abilities

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Experience with programming languages such as Python, Java, R, or SQL
  • Knowledge of statistical analysis and data visualization tools, such as PowerBI or Tableau
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office

About Heritage Construction + Materials

Heritage Construction + Materials (HC+M) is part of The Heritage Group, a privately held, family-owned business headquartered in Indianapolis. HC+M has core capabilities in infrastructure building. Its collection of companies provides innovative road construction and materials services across the Midwest. HC+M companies, including Asphalt Materials, Inc., Evergreen Roadworks, The Hoosier Company, Milestone Contractors and US Aggregates, proudly employ 3,000 people at 68 locations across seven states.
